Offer description

Edit and deliver high-quality video content for Nine News programs using AVID Media Composer, collaborating with editorial teams in a fast-paced newsroom.


Your role

Responsibilities

* Editing material for Nine News broadcasts, including voiceovers, grabs, overlay, and packages, as well as feature-style content for news, current affairs, online, and streaming platforms.
* Compiling vision for archive and ensuring edited material is delivered correctly and on time.
* Escalating potential technical problems to the Supervisor or engineering team in a timely manner.
* Ensuring all edited material meets high technical standards and is delivered within strict deadlines.
* Working under pressure in a fast-paced environment.
* Being available to work a rotating roster based in the office, including weekends, early starts, and late finishes.
* Collaborating closely with editorial stakeholders to produce high-calibre content.


About you

Qualifications

* Tertiary qualifications or equivalent professional experience in media, TV production, or communications.
* Proficiency in editing software; AVID Media Composer experience is a plus, but not required.
* Technical knowledge of media file formats and compression codecs.
* Dedication, professionalism, flexibility, and a proactive "can-do" approach with a positive attitude.
* A genuine desire to build a long-term career in television broadcasting and streaming.
* A keen interest in news, sport, and current affairs.
* The right to lawfully work and live in Australia.
